DTC B2470 

Circuit Description 

The cellular portion of the cellular and navigation antenna is connected to the vehicle communication interface 
module (VCIM) with a RG-174 coax cable. The VCIM polls the data from the antenna once every second. 

Conditions for Running the DTC 

z

The ignition must be in the RUN or ACC position.  

z

The system voltage is at least 9.5 volts and no more than 15.5 volts.  

z

All the above conditions are present for greater than 1 second.  

Conditions for Setting the DTC 

z

The VCIM does not detect the presence of the cellular antenna  

z

All the above conditions are present for greater than 1 second.  

Action Taken When the DTC Sets 

z

The OnStar(R) status LED turns RED.  

z

The vehicle is unable to connect to the OnStar(R) Call Center.

DTC B2476 

Circuit Description 

The OnStar(R) button assembly consists of three buttons, Call/Answer, OnStar(R) Call Center and OnStar(R) 
Emergency. Ten volts is supplied to the button assembly on the Keypad Supply Voltage circuit. Each of the 
buttons, when pressed, completes the circuit across a resister allowing a specific voltage to be returned to the 
vehicle communication interface module (VCIM) on the Keypad Signal circuit. Depending upon the voltage 
range returned, the VCIM is able to identify which button has been pressed. 

Conditions for Running the DTC 

z

The ignition must be in the RUN or ACC position.  

z

The system voltage is at least 9.5 volts and no more than 15.5 volts.  

z

All the above conditions are present for greater than 300 ms.  

Conditions for Setting the DTC 

z

The VCIM powers the button assembly through the keypad supply voltage circuit for 11.5 ms, turns the 
power off, then waits for 50 ms and sees a voltage value greater than 1.8 volts on this circuit.  

z

The above conditions are present for greater than 300 ms.  

Action Taken When the DTC Sets 

z

The VCIM will ignore all inputs from the OnStar(R) button assembly.  

z

No calls can be placed.
